So Hirshberg is looking for other options abroad, including buying organic-milk powder from a co-op of 35 family farms in New Zealand to reconstitute in limited amounts for Stonyfield products. He is discussing ways to finance the changes with his prospective partners. Hirshberg has also persuaded Danone managers in four European countries to move into organic products this year, and he expects 11 more countries to follow in 2007, assuming they can find the cows. He hopes demand from Europe will stimulate the supply of organic milk here and abroad.
But where does that leave Yoplait, which thus far has sat on the sidelines of the organic and probiotics trends? Analysts say it could buy its way in. The obvious target would be Horizon, the No. 2 brand in organic dairy products. But Waldron appears content to enjoy Yoplait's spot as the nation's No. 1 brand. He would say only that he is watching for the day when "emerging yogurt segments will have more mass appeal."
Until then, General Mills is finding new ways to ride the growth wave. Its cereal division has Yogurt Burst Cheerios, which means you can expect Kellogg's to respond with Yogurt Froot Loops, perhaps? The other yogurt brands, meanwhile, are too busy restocking grocery shelves to worry about rivals. "We can make this category explode even more," says Dannon CEO Dalto. "Then we can fight for market share."
